Four Kinds of Pubic Hair

1971
20th century
292 x 216 mm (11.5 x 8.5 in.)

Jim Dine, American, b. born 1935

Object Type: print
Medium and Support: Etching on F. J. Head Home Made paper
Print impression quality: Excellent
Series: Number 1 from set of four etchings Four Kinds of Pubic Hair
Edition: Artist’s Proof from edition of 50 plus 10 Artist’s Proofs; proofed and editioned by Maurice Payne; published by Petersburg Press, London.
Marks: Signed in pencil, lower right with edition number and date
Marks: Watermark: F.J. Head Home Made
Bibliography: Williams College Museum of Art, Jim Dine Prints: 1970–1977 (New York: Harper & Row, 1977), cat. nos. 39–42 for the set.
Credit Line: Gift of the artist in honor of John R. Jakobson (BA Wesleyan 1952, LLD 1989, Trustee 1971–1985), 1989
Accession Number: 1989.21.1.1
